5.12 Planning and installation
5.12.1 Creating a material list
Use this worksheet to make an initial material list
for the amount of tubing and fasteners needed.
Then select one worksheet below to create a piping
and control material list. These charts are intended
for conceptual purposes; there may be variations in
each job.
Equation: Snow melt area x multiplier =
estimated amount
Example: For a snow melt area of 500 ft
2
with
tubing at 9" spacing, the estimated amount is
500 x 1.5 = 750 ft. The fasteners required for the
same area at 9" spacing are found as 500 x 0.75 =
375 pieces.
The number of circuits in the area will be covered
in the following section. Installer’s preference
determines the choice of fasteners. (Use plastic zip
ties for 3/4" tubing.)

Plastic fasteners that are supplied by Viega include
zip ties, foam staples and U-channels.
5.12.2 Layout planning
To avoid waste and to have equal circuit lengths,
a carefully planned layout should be done. First,
determine where the manifold should be installed.
Remember the manifold must be accessible. When
calculating the number of circuits, always round
up. Keep the length of each circuit the same in the
snow melt area.
Tubing Size Max. Circuit Length (ft)
" 200
¾" 300
Table 5-20 Maximum circuit lengths

Table 5-21 Loop lengths for snow melt systems
(See Clause 17.4.3.2)
NOTES:
1. 13 mm (½") tube should not be used. The total
PEX loop lengths consist of two separate sections,
the active loop and the leader length. The active
loop is installed within the heated slab. The
leader length is the total distance to and from the
manifold and heated slab, including any vertical
distances.
2. The manifolds should be installed as close to the
snow melt area as possible.
(CSA B214, Clause 17.4.3.2)
The maximum length of continuous tubing from a
supply-and-return manifold arrangement shall not
exceed the lengths specied by the manufacturer or,
in the absence of manufacturer’s specications, the
lengths specied in Table 3. Actual loop lengths shall
be determined by spacing, ow rate, temperature and
pressure drop, as specied in the system design.
